Treating Anxiety Disorders: From Racing Thoughts to Calm
Anxiety disorders are characterized by persistent, excessive worry that can interfere with daily activities. Effective treatment for anxiety involves strategies to calm the mind, regulate emotions, and reduce the physiological symptoms associated with anxiety. Techniques such as cognitive-behavioral therapy, exposure therapy, and relaxation exercises are commonly employed to help individuals manage their anxiety and improve their quality of life.

Insomnia Solutions: Behavioral Sleep Reeducation
Insomnia can be debilitating, impacting various aspects of health and well-being. Behavioral sleep reeducation aims to address the behaviors and habits that contribute to sleep disturbances. Techniques such as sleep hygiene education, relaxation training, and cognitive behavioral therapy for insomnia are used to promote healthy sleep patterns and improve overall sleep quality.
Bipolar Treatment: Understanding Bipolar Cycles
Bipolar disorder is characterized by extreme mood swings, including emotional highs (mania or hypomania) and lows (depression). Understanding and managing these cycles are crucial in the treatment of bipolar disorder. Treatment typically involves a combination of medication and psychotherapy to stabilize mood swings and provide strategies for dealing with symptoms effectively.
OCD Support: Coping with OCD Anxiety
Obsessive-Compulsive Disorder (OCD) involves unwanted, intrusive thoughts (obsessions) and repetitive behaviors (compulsions). Therapy for OCD focuses on reducing the anxiety associated with obsessions and decreasing reliance on compulsive behaviors. Exposure and response prevention (ERP), a type of cognitive-behavioral therapy, is particularly effective in treating OCD.

What should I expect during my first appointment with a psychiatrist in Sunshine Park Mobile Home Park?
During your first appointment, the psychiatrist will likely conduct a thorough assessment which may include discussing your medical, psychiatric, and family history, current symptoms, and any previous treatments. They will also discuss your treatment goals and create a personalized treatment plan. It’s a good opportunity to ask any questions and address concerns you may have.
